Master of Arts in Communication
Study plan
I. Program Duration
The normal study period of Master of Arts in Communication program is 2 years. The maximum study period is 3 years. (Students admitted in or before academic year 2018/2019, please refer to the rules and regulations as stipulated in the intake academic year study plan)
II. Study Mode
Lectures
III. Medium of Instruction
Chinese or English
IV. Academic Field
Communication and Media Studies
V. Major
Integrated Marketing Communication
New Media Communication
VI. Course Structure

VII. Teaching Requirements
- Students are required to complete four core courses, one course under specific major, three elective courses, and academic activities (ten times of attendance) during the first 3 semesters to gain 25 credits.
- Students are required to complete an original research master’s thesis of at least 20,000 words and pass the thesis oral defense.
- After finishing each course, students will be assessed based on regulations established by the instructor and the Faculty.
VIII. Study Time
- The duration for taking all courses is 18 months and the duration for thesis writing is 6 months.
- Classes will generally be scheduled from Monday to Sunday, daytime or at nights.
IX. Graduation Requirements
Upon approval from the Senate of the University, a Master’s Degree will be conferred on a student when he or she has:
- completed and met the requirements prescribed in the study plan of his or her program within the specific study period, and achieved a cumulative GPA of 2.50 or above (excluding dissertation); and
- abided by the regulations of the University; and
- cleared all fees and charges and returned all University’s property and equipment borrowed.
If the student pass all courses required in Table 1, 2, 3 and 5 above with a cumulative GPA of 2.5 or above, but fails to submit or pass the final thesis oral defense during the specified period, he/she can only get a completion certificate.
